如何利用API函数查询器实现高效开发:解决开发者查询难题的实用指南
在现代软件开发过程中,API的使用无疑是技术人员绕不开的重要环节。随着项目规模的扩大和技术栈的多样化,开发者往往需要频繁地查阅各种API函数文档,检索调用方式、输入参数、返回值含义及使用场景。然而,面对庞大的API文档和凌乱的资源,如何快速定位所需函数信息、准确理解函数功能,成为摆在开发者面前的一大挑战。正因如此,API函数查询器作为一款集成化、智能化的工具,应运而生,帮开发者大幅提升API使用效率。
一、痛点分析:开发者在API查询中面临的困境
在日益繁忙的项目进度中,开发者经常遇到以下几大难题:
- 信息量过载,查找效率低下:面对庞大且不断更新的API文档,如无高效工具辅助,开发者往往需要花费大量时间翻阅海量内容,浪费宝贵时间。
- 函数用途和参数理解模糊:尤其是初学者或跨语言迁移的开发者,经常对函数的参数类型、返回值及其业务含义理解不足,导致调用错误或效率低下。
- 缺乏示例和应用案例:仅有文字描述往往难以快速掌握函数调用要领,缺少代码示例会使学习曲线陡峭。
- 跨平台、多语言支持不足:很多API文档局限于某个特定环境,面对多项目、多语言场景时,查询体验不佳。
以上问题不仅影响开发效率,还可能导致项目迭代拖延和质量下降。因此,如何快速精准地查询API函数,成为开发者迫切需要解决的关键问题。
二、解决方案:借助API函数查询器提升查询体验与开发效率
针对上述痛点,API函数查询器以其智能化、集成化的设计理念,为开发者提供了一整套解决方案:
- 集成多来源文档:自动同步官方API文档、社区贡献说明及用户自定义注释,构建全面、一站式查询平台。
- 智能搜索与过滤:支持关键词模糊搜索、参数类型筛选、错误提示纠正,帮助用户迅速定位目标函数。
- 详细参数说明与示例:展示各参数含义、取值范围以及丰富的代码示例,降低理解门槛。
- 多语言文档支持:满足跨平台及多编程语言开发需求,统一查询界面体验。
- 交互式调用测试:部分查询器集成API调试功能,直接在页面测试函数调用效果,缩短开发和调试周期。
综合来看,API函数查询器不仅解决了资料检索的难题,也极大地丰富了开发者对API的认知,为后续代码实现提供了有力保障。
三、步骤详解:如何高效利用API函数查询器实现具体目标
步骤一:明确开发需求,锁定目标API范围
开发者在使用API函数查询器之前,首先要清晰定义当前工作中的具体需求是什么——是实现数据交换、文件处理,还是网络请求等。此步骤有助于缩小查询目标,避免盲目搜索,提高检索效率。
步骤二:启动API函数查询器并进行关键词搜索
打开API函数查询器,输入与任务相关的关键词。例如,如果需实现“文件读取”,可以输入“read file”或“文件读取”等常用词。查询器的智能算法会快速列出相关函数列表,并根据使用频率、精准度排序。
步骤三:筛选与比较候选函数,确定最合适的调用方式
对比各候选函数的详细信息,例如参数列表、返回值说明、异常处理方式等。API函数查询器通常会配备简洁明了的表格或卡片视图,使得对比过程一目了然。此时,用户还可查看开发者社区的评价、常见问题或使用指南,辅助决策。
步骤四:阅读代码示例,理解调用语法
代码示例是快速理解API用法的关键。API函数查询器提供的示例代码通常涵盖不同语言版本和典型场景,帮助开发者直观掌握正确用法,避免常见错误。
步骤五:利用交互式调用测试功能现场调试
如查询器支持调用测试,开发者可直接在平台进行函数测试,实时观察输入及输出效果,大幅减少调试成本,缩短开发周期。
步骤六:将查询得到的知识转化为代码实现,集成到项目中
将确认无误的API调用语法和参数应用到实际项目开发中,并结合查询到的异常处理提示和优化建议进行编码,确保功能的稳定高效完成。
四、效果预期:应用API函数查询器带来的显著提升
经过上述步骤,高效利用API函数查询器不仅解决了传统手动查找API的诸多困扰,还带来了多方面显著成效:
- 快速定位与准确调用:节约查找时间,提升API函数使用的准确率,有效避免因盲目调用导致的bug。
- 学习成本大幅降低:详尽说明与示例代码减少了理解难度,帮助新手快速掌握关键API技能。
- 开发流程更加高效:交互测试和直观对比功能缩短了调试和决策时间,提升整体开发速度和质量。
- 跨平台、多语言支持:满足多样化项目需求,增强开发灵活性和可扩展性。
综上所述,API函数查询器不仅是一款简单的工具,更是一种提升软件开发核心竞争力的利器。凡是想要突破传统API文档阅读瓶颈、实现快速开发的团队和个人,都应积极采纳并深度利用这一工具,为项目交付增添坚实保障。
结语
时代在进步,软件开发的复杂度也在增大。虽然API为功能实现打开了快捷通道,但如何充分理解与正确使用,依旧是开发者必须跨越的挑战。借助API函数查询器,开发者能够告别繁重的手动搜索与低效查阅,快速拿到最需要的信息,显著提升代码质量和开发效率。未来,随着人工智能及大数据技术的不断发展,API函数查询器也必将朝着更加智能化、个性化的方向进化,成为开发者手中更加强大的“助攻神器”。
评论 (0)